We are seeking a Senior Water Resources Engineer / Project Manager to lead and coordinate a variety of engineering design services focused on hydrology, hydraulics, drainage, stormwater management, water quality retrofits, and stream restoration or mitigation efforts.This role involves managing feasibility studies, preparing detailed design plans and construction documentation, supporting project permitting, and overseeing construction-phase services. The engineer will contribute technical expertise on large watershed studies or multiple smaller-scale projects with complex drainage systems.The ideal candidate will apply both standard and advanced hydrologic and hydraulic modeling techniques, ensure compliance with municipal and federal regulations, and engage effectively with internal teams and external stakeholders. Strong communication skills and a commitment to technical excellence are essential—along with a desire for career growth into senior project management roles.Key Responsibilities:
  • Manage mid-sized to large-scale stormwater and water resources projects, including scope, schedule, budget, deliverables, and quality assurance.
  • Lead or support engineering analysis on watershed and stormwater projects of varying complexity
  • Collaborate with internal teams to develop detailed hydrologic and hydraulic (H&H) models and prepare accompanying technical reports
  • Apply both standard and advanced modeling methods and engineering principles across various water resources disciplines
  • Engage with internal and external stakeholders, requiring clear and professional communication skills
  • Assist in the preparation of construction cost estimates, design drawings, and technical specifications
  • Mentor junior staff and support training efforts across the team
Qualifications – Education:
  • Bachelor’s degree in Civil Engineering or related field
  • Licensed Professional Engineer (PE) with ability to obtain reciprocity in the state of Texas
  • Certified Floodplain Manager (CFM) not required but highly desirable
Qualifications – Experience & Skills:
  • Demonstrated ability to manage projects or task orders, meet deadlines, and work collaboratively with diverse teams.
  • Minimum of 7+ years of professional experience performing H&H modeling, stormwater detention design, FEMA LOMCs, and floodplain mitigation planning
  • Hands-on proficiency with some or all of the following models: HEC-RAS (steady, unsteady, and/or 2D), HEC-HMS, InfoWorks ICM, XP-SWMM, and/or ICPR4 (Stormwise)
  • Experience with the application of GIS in H&H modeling
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to clearly convey technical information to clients and stakeholders.
  • Experience with local, state, or federal clients and knowledge of applicable regulations and permitting processes
  • Proven ability to develop strong client and team relationships
